Movie Car Posters

Posted by Hal Thomas on February 22, 2012

Looking for something new to adorn the walls of your creative space? Do you like cars? Do you like movies? Do you like cars and movies? Enough with the questions already!

If the answer to any of the above questions is yes, then check out MovieCarPosters.com. The site offers illustrated posters spotlighting some of the most iconic rides in the history of film, and at $10 a pop, they're a steal!

Words of Workplace Wisdom

Posted by Hal Thomas on November 01, 2011

Forget about avoiding discussions of race, religion, sex and politics, these screen-printed posters from Division of Labor serve as handy reminders of all the really important rules for the new workplace. At only $35 for the set of five, I have a feeling these may be coming soon to an office wall near me.
